Steel stocks edged up on announcement of customs duty on stainless steel, flat products, high steel bars to be revoked. Also, customs duty exemption on steel scrap to be extended for another year for small- and medium-sized businesses
Tata Steel is currently trading at Rs. 1137.05, up by 51.60 points or 4.75% from its previous closing of Rs. 1085.45 on the BSE. The scrip opened at Rs. 1110.00 and has touched a high and low of Rs. 1140.95 and Rs. 1086.60 respectively.
Steel Authority of India is currently trading at Rs. 101.60, up by 3.20 points or 3.25% from its previous closing of Rs. 98.40 on the BSE. The scrip opened at Rs. 99.70 and has touched a high and low of Rs. 101.60 and Rs. 98.15 respectively.
JSW Steel is currently trading at Rs. 641.25, up by 12.05 points or 1.92% from its previous closing of Rs. 629.20 on the BSE. The scrip opened at Rs. 635.40 and has touched a high and low of Rs. 644.90 and Rs. 628.05 respectively.
